Wink Motorola Radio + 8 track player

Sorry for the add on but I forgot to mention that the Motorola radio and 8 track player seem to work fine except that there is a loud humming in the background no matter what I do. Do's anyone have thoughts on this? Someone said it is the converter when on A/C. Some one else said it is an improper ground, but I'm not sure what to do about it as the radio works fine and it looks so cool.

I thought I once heard the old converters had three outputs, one for the batteries, one for things that didn't need filtered power, and one for those that did. Is it possible it's on the wrong power lead from the converter?

Isolate the supply source. If it is 12vdc, direct connect to battery, if 110ac, run an extension from the house. Take the converter out of the equation if possible....
